diff --git a/boskos/cluster/boskos-crds.yaml b/boskos/cluster/boskos-crds.yaml new file mode 100644 index 00000000000..a32a2883899 --- /dev/null +++ b/boskos/cluster/boskos-crds.yaml @@ -0,0 +1,35 @@ +apiVersion: apiextensions.k8s.io/v1beta1 +kind: CustomResourceDefinition +metadata: + name: dynamicresourcelifecycles.boskos.k8s.io +spec: + group: boskos.k8s.io + names: + kind: DRLCObject + listKind: DRLCObjectList + plural: dynamicresourcelifecycles + singular: dynamicresourcelifecycle + scope: Namespaced + version: v1 + versions: + - name: v1 + served: true + storage: true +--- +apiVersion: apiextensions.k8s.io/v1beta1 +kind: CustomResourceDefinition +metadata: + name: resources.boskos.k8s.io +spec: + group: boskos.k8s.io + names: + kind: ResourceObject + listKind: ResourceObjectList + plural: resources + singular: resource + scope: Namespaced + version: v1 + versions: + - name: v1 + served: true + storage: true diff --git a/boskos/cluster/boskos-deployment.yaml b/boskos/cluster/boskos-deployment.yaml index cdd797dbe93..cdf094f15ba 100644 --- a/boskos/cluster/boskos-deployment.yaml +++ b/boskos/cluster/boskos-deployment.yaml @@ -68,7 +68,7 @@ spec: terminationGracePeriodSeconds: 30 containers: - name: boskos - image: gcr.io/k8s-prow/boskos/boskos:v20190730-dbac84bd7 + image: gcr.io/k8s-staging-boskos/boskos:v20200819-984516e args: - --config=/etc/config/resources.yaml - --namespace=boskos diff --git a/boskos/cluster/cleaner-deployment.yaml b/boskos/cluster/cleaner-deployment.yaml index 125c20bd540..60adb83c792 100644 --- a/boskos/cluster/cleaner-deployment.yaml +++ b/boskos/cluster/cleaner-deployment.yaml @@ -60,7 +60,7 @@ spec: terminationGracePeriodSeconds: 300 containers: - name: boskos-cleaner - image: gcr.io/k8s-prow/boskos/cleaner:v20190730-dbac84bd7 + image: gcr.io/k8s-staging-boskos/cleaner:v20200819-984516e args: - --cleaner-count=3 - --namespace=boskos diff --git a/boskos/cluster/janitor-deployment.yaml b/boskos/cluster/janitor-deployment.yaml index b0f2eec6348..a8836be800c 100644 --- a/boskos/cluster/janitor-deployment.yaml +++ b/boskos/cluster/janitor-deployment.yaml @@ -16,7 +16,7 @@ spec: terminationGracePeriodSeconds: 300 containers: - name: boskos-janitor - image: gcr.io/k8s-testimages/janitor:v20180725-c421ed4f9 + image: gcr.io/k8s-staging-boskos/janitor:v20200819-984516e args: - --service-account=/etc/service-account/service-account.json - --resource-type=gcp-project,gcp-perf-test diff --git a/boskos/cluster/metrics-deployment.yaml b/boskos/cluster/metrics-deployment.yaml index c16b3fbcd6f..fdfad57b3d0 100644 --- a/boskos/cluster/metrics-deployment.yaml +++ b/boskos/cluster/metrics-deployment.yaml @@ -17,7 +17,7 @@ spec: terminationGracePeriodSeconds: 30 containers: - name: metrics - image: gcr.io/k8s-prow/boskos/metrics:v20190730-dbac84bd7 + image: gcr.io/k8s-staging-boskos/metrics:v20200819-984516e args: - --resource-type=gke-perf-preset,gcp-perf-test,gcp-project,gke-e2e-test ports: diff --git a/boskos/cluster/reaper-deployment.yaml b/boskos/cluster/reaper-deployment.yaml index da265047f9e..96ce8ab68d3 100644 --- a/boskos/cluster/reaper-deployment.yaml +++ b/boskos/cluster/reaper-deployment.yaml @@ -16,7 +16,7 @@ spec: terminationGracePeriodSeconds: 30 containers: - name: boskos-reaper - image: gcr.io/k8s-prow/boskos/reaper:v20190730-dbac84bd7 + image: gcr.io/k8s-staging-boskos/reaper:v20200819-984516e args: - --resource-type=gke-perf-preset,gcp-perf-test,gcp-project,gke-e2e-test tolerations: